The New York Foundation for the Arts (NYFA), in partnership with New York State Council on the Arts’ (NYSCA) State & Local Partnerships program, will present a free public program for artists of all disciplines in collaboration with Flushing Town Hall. This programming is part of NYFA’s entrepreneurial training in Queens, focusing on artists living and working in Queens County and New York City.

NYFA will present an overview of our free and low-cost national programs and services. Whether you’re trying to raise money to finish a particular project, seeking feedback on your work, looking for an artist residency, or trying to find a job, NYFA has resources that you can use to help you sustain and grow your practice. We will also provide information on the NYSCA/NYFA Artist as Entrepreneur program, which will be held throughout New York State in 2023. Additionally, Flushing Town Hall will share an overview of the grants and services it offers to local artists.
